We are seeing an issue where RingCentral AI transcripts / call summaries are sometimes mapping call participants to the wrong contact.

The issue appears inconsistent. In some calls, the participant/contact recognition seems correct, but in other calls the AI summary assigns the wrong person as the contact or labels the participants incorrectly.

Hi ​@Lucasfss  Thanks for the feedback. Currently the transcript service use CallerID and RingCentral contacts for participant identify. We will need check how to pass contact from CRM to transcript service.
